GRINDER.
SPECIFICATION forming part of Letters Patent No. 482,400, dated September 13, 1892. Application filled February 29, 1892. Serial No. 423,222. (No model.)
until its hoppers have been exhausted and it is necessary to refill them.
The invention consists in the construction and novel combination and arrangement of parts hereinafter fully described, illustrated in the accompanying drawings, and pointed out in the claims hereto appended.
In the drawings, Figure 1 is a vertical sectional view of a mill for grinding mica constructed in accordance with this invention. Fig. 2 is an end elevation. Fig. 3 is a transverse Sectional View of one of the hoppers. Fig. 4 is a longitudinal sectional View of the same. Fig. is a detail View of one of the operating-levers, illustrating its engagement with one of the ratchet-wheels.
Like numerals of reference indicate corresponding parts in all the figures of the drawings.
1 designates a frame having journaled in suitable bearings of it a longitudinally-disposed shaft 2, which has its ends extending into oppositely-disposed hoppers 3 and carrying grinding-disks 4E, and Which has mounted upon it intermediate its ends pulleys 5, designed to be connected by belts with a suitable motive power. Each hopper 3 is cylindrical and consists of a stationary section 6, in which is arranged one of the grinding-disks, and a hinged section 7, which is hinged at its bottom at S and is provided at its top with a catch 9, and is adapted to be lowered to bring its inner end in a horizontal position for lling, as illustrated in dotted lines in Fig. 1. The mica to be ground is placed in the hophave their lower ends engaging the plungers and a chain 12, connected with the levers at intermediate points of the latter. The levers 11 are drawn together to advance the plungers by means of a windlass consisting of a shaft 13, ratchet-wheelslll, rigidly secured to the ends of the shaft, and detachable operating-levers l 5, which engage the ratchet-Wheels and are adapted to rotate the shaft 13 to Wind the chain and which are rendered automatic in their action by means of adjustable Weights 16. The operating-lever 15 has its engaging end 17 forked and curved inward and adapted to straddle a ratchet-wheel and to receive the shaft vin its curved portions, and it is provided With a spring-actuated pawl 18, arranged to engage the adjacent ratchet-wheel and adapted to be Withdrawn from such engagement to permit the operating-lever to be readily detached. The two operating-levers,
Vby means of the adjustable Weights, produce a constant pressure on the plungers, and when one of them falls toward a perpendicular it may be raised Without releasing the shaft, as the other operating-lever will still be in engagement with the other ratchetwheel.
It is desirable to grind the mica as fine as possible, and the grinding-disk of each hopper has its periphery arranged close to the stationary section 6, and the ground mica is carried between the periphery ot' the grinding-disk and the section 6 to a discharge- Opening 19 by means of Water discharged upon the center of the grinding-disk from a water-pipe 20. The Water-pipe communicates with a tank 21, which is located at the top of the frame; and it consists of a rigid portion or metal pipe 22, which is mounted in the hinged section of the hopper, and a dexible section 23, which extends from the top of the hopper to the tank to permit the hinged section to swing downward for the purpose of filling the hopper. The inner end 24 of the rigid section 22 is arranged horizontally and is located Within a recess 25 of the grindingdisk, whereby the water will be equally distributed over the grinding-face of the disk. The supply of water is regulated by a valve 26, arranged adjacent to the tank 2l; The rigid section 22 of the water-pipe is inclined and is mounted in a vertical partition or iiange 27, which supports and braces it and which depends from the top of a hinged section of a hopper. The plunger is provided in its head with an opening 29 to receive the partition or flange 27, and is guided by the latter and has its rod composed of two bars 28, arranged on opposite sides of the partition of iange and provided at their outer ends with points 30, engaging the lower end of the adjacent lever 11, which is composed or a pair of bars spaced by blocks.
It will be seen that the mill is simple and comparatively inexpensive in construction, that the material will be readily supplied, and that when its hoppers are full it will not require attention until it is necessary to refill them. The water delivered upon the grinding-disks is necessary to the operation of grinding, and it also conveys the ground mica to the discharge-openings.
